FIFA To Ban Any Player Seeking A Deliberate Yellow Card

FIFA "will ban any England or Belgium player if they try to earn a deliberate yellow card to seek an easier path to the final" when the teams meet on Thursday, according to Martyn Ziegler of the LONDON TIMES. Finishing second in group G "could be preferable to winning in terms of the likely opposition" in the quarterfinals and semifinals and both sides "are exactly level on points, goal difference and goals scored." England tops the group, "having had two cautions to Belgium’s three," so if the match ends in a draw without any further cards shown, then Gareth Southgate’s side would go through to the second round as group winner, with a possible quarterfinal against Brazil or Germany "on the horizon." Some commentators "have suggested that England should be wily and pick up a couple of bookings on purpose" if the match is heading for a draw to finish in second and aim for a possible quarterfinal against Mexico or Switzerland (LONDON TIMES, 6/25).

'RISKING PUNISHMENT': In London, Ben Rumsby reported England fans "have been warned any pro-Brexit chants" during the game against Belgium risk punishment by FIFA. The governing body said that the FA would be sanctioned if Three Lions supporters breach its rules on "displaying insulting or political slogans in any form" and "uttering insulting words or sounds" during Thursday's match. A FIFA spokesperson said, "Of course, there is a risk of some kind of punishment to the FA" (TELEGRAPH, 6/25).
